There is Nothing New

March 12, 2020 by Tim Sherfy

History is cyclical. There always seems to be a reason for people to panic or worry. Whether it’s the climate, a disease, or tumbling financial markets, it’s easy to become overwhelmed by the news of the day. It’s important to keep our perspective when worry creeps into our hearts. The first thing to remember is God has been in control since the beginning, and He will be in control at the end. Nothing His creation does catches God off guard. Our omnipotent Creator always has a contingency plan.

Not only is He in control, but He is also always with us (Deuteronomy 31:6). We face nothing on this earth alone. While the media often declares we are experiencing the worst crisis in history if you’ve lived long enough, you know we’ve seen this all before. As Solomon, the wisest man who ever lived once said, “There is nothing new under the sun” (Ecclesiastes 1:9).

The Faithfulness of God

February 24, 2020 by Tim Sherfy

All followers of Jesus desire to grow in their faith. We feel if we had more faith, we wouldn’t get so stressed out or worry as much. So, we pray and study; we beg and plead, all the while asking God for more faith. What if we’re focusing on the wrong thing? What if, instead of focusing on our own faith, we focused on the faithfulness of God?

His love and provision are everlasting. They never fail. He never leaves our side and is always going with us, no matter what we may face (Deuteronomy 31:6). I believe if we grasped the faithfulness of God, the need for our own faith would be almost irrelevant. He is already more than we could ever need.

Diverse and Eclectic

January 30, 2020 by Tim Sherfy

Most of us hang around people who look like us, think like us, and share the same beliefs as we do. Being charged with furthering Jesus’s mission to bring the Kingdom of Heaven to earth, I find it difficult to believe Heaven looks like our homogeneous gatherings. No, I think Heaven is the most diverse and eclectic bunch of people we can imagine. If that’s true, why don’t we strive to surround ourselves with similar gatherings now?

This life is our only chance to prepare for our eternal one. We may as well practice now. Paul encourages us in Romans 15:7 to accept others just as Christ accepted us.  Jesus takes us as we are. We should also accept others as they are without demanding they become like us. God loves them just as they are, and so should we.

Jesus is Not an Institution

January 13, 2020 by Tim Sherfy

A pastor shared a cartoon drawing of Mary and baby Jesus. In the cartoon, Mary is comforting Jesus and asks if he had a nightmare. Jesus replies, “Yes, I dreamed I became an institution!” I don’t know what your reaction is to this, whether it’s laughter, disgust, or ambivalence. For me, it cut me to the core. What would Jesus think if He came back today to assess the state of the Church?

What are we doing with and to the plan He has for our redemption? He spent His life showing how we should love and care for others. That is the essence of why the Church exists. God intends for us to represent Him here on earth. Instead, we’ve become just another business organization complete with heavy debts and ever-increasing administrative budgets.
